After the trip to sea, the ship TH 91427-TS owned by ship owner and pilot Nguyen Van Do, from Hung Loc commune (Hau Loc) and the ship TH 92323-TS owned by ship owner and pilot To Van Ngo, from Ngu Loc commune, docked at Hoa Loc fishing port. Ngo's ship had 8 workers on board. Ngo has been working at sea for over 20 years, while Do has been at sea for over 10 years.

Mr. Ngo, Mr. Do and many other fishermen who are attached to the seafaring profession shared that the current difficulties of offshore fishermen are the gradually depleting resources, extreme weather, and climate change that continuously affect the exploitation of aquatic products. In the areas of Lach Truong estuary, storm shelters, and the area in front of the wharf are not dredged regularly, so there is sedimentation, leading to narrowing of the channel, shallow ports and shelters, making it very difficult for fishing vessels to enter and exit the port to unload goods as well as enter the storm shelters. Many offshore fishing vessels of fishermen entering the port to unload goods and shelter from storms have to wait for many hours, waiting for the tide to rise.

Mr. Nguyen Dinh Anh, Deputy Head of Thanh Hoa Fishing Port Management Board, in charge of Hoa Loc fishing port, shared: On hot summer days, fishermen return to Hoa Loc fishing port early in the morning or at night. Ships passing through Hoa Loc fishing port are mainly fishermen from Hau Loc and Hoang Hoa districts. In recent times, Hoa Loc fishing port has always done a good job of disseminating and popularizing the Party's policies and the State's laws, legal documents, and the 2017 Fisheries Law on the management of fishing ports and storm shelters, and on combating illegal, unreported and unregulated fishing on a daily and weekly basis on the port's loudspeaker system.

The fishing port management board directs the development of port regulations, posts and public announcements at the fishing port and guides organizations and individuals operating in the fishing port area and storm shelter areas to implement them. Regularly propagates and reminds organizations and individuals operating in the port about their responsibility to preserve and protect the environment and food hygiene and safety; signs contracts with local environmental sanitation teams to collect daily household waste in the fishing port area; the board's staff regularly organizes cleaning of the fishing port area, especially when fishing vessels have finished delivering and receiving products, ensuring environmental sanitation in the port. Coordinates with Da Loc Border Guard Station and Hoa Loc Commune Police to organize security and order in the fishing port area. Therefore, up to now, there have been no incidents causing insecurity and disorder in the fishing port.

Arrange a 24/7 force at the port area to organize management and dispatch; guide ships, vehicles carrying seafood and refueling, necessities for ships... to avoid congestion, causing disorder and insecurity; ensure environmental sanitation. After the ship unloads or delivers goods, arrange a force to guide ships to leave the wharf area, creating space for other ships to dock; monitor the volume of seafood unloaded through the port; collect and check fishing logs; collect correctly and fully all fees and charges according to State regulations.

In the first 4 months of 2025, the number of ships leaving Hoa Loc fishing port was 897, the number of ships arriving at the port was 927. The total cargo through the port reached nearly 3,000 tons. Of which, aquatic products were more than 2,000 tons, the rest were other goods such as: ice, diesel oil, clean water...
